Sets a delay in the I path in ns.
Remote-control command:
SOUR:IMP:DEL:I 2
Sets a delay in the Q path in ns.
Remote-control command:
SOUR:IMP:DEL:Q 1.25
Enters the IF modulation frequency (frequency offset) in Hz.
Remote-control command:
SOUR:FOFF 1E6
